Wells + Associates Receives National Award for Excellence in Transportation Demand Management from ACT

W+A Recognized Among Industry Leaders at Trade Conference in Denver

Tysons, VA — Wells + Associates recently accepted the Excellence in Research Award at the Association for Commuter Transportation (ACT) 38th Annual International Conference in Denver, Colorado. The award was one of 13 distributed at the association’s 2024 ACT National Awards, which honor those performing exemplary work in Transportation Demand Management (TDM).  

The award was granted for our firm’s white paper, “Don’t Underestimate Your Property: Forecasting Trips and Managing Density Over the Long Term in Fairfax County, Virginia.” Other winners included individuals and organizations committed to improving commuter and community mobility to create a better journey for all.

W+A’s research made clear what our TDM team already knew: that TDM was reducing traffic at our Fairfax County, Virginia, properties, and that our clients met their proferred requirements year after year. The key findings of the research are that 1) properties with TDM programs were achieving twice the amount of trip reduction as they were required to, and 2) Fairfax County’s urbanization and transportation-oriented development efforts had created synergies with the TDM trip reduction proffers, making the combined policies more successful than the county had anticipated.

About the Association for Commuter Transportation (ACT)

The Association for Commuter Transportationis the premier organization and leading advocate for commuter transportation and Transportation Demand Management (TDM) professionals.  ACT strives to create an efficient multimodal transportation system by empowering the people, places, and organizations working to advance TDM to improve the quality of life of commuters, enhance the livability of communities, and stimulate economic activity.
